
Jaewon Peter Chun
Jaewon Peter Chun is President of World Smart Cities Forum (WSCF) with 10-year experience of smart city masterplan including London, Ukraine, Vietnam, and South Korea. In particular, he designed a master plan of 6-billion USD South Korea national smart city pilot project as a master planner in 2018. Later, he signed a mandate agreement with the Ministry of Communities and Territories Development of Ukraine (Currently, Ministry of Restoration of Ukraine) on establishing the national smart city projects in Ukraine in 2021.
After the war broke out in Ukraine, he and WSCF launched ‘The Global TWIN CITIES Initiative’, a single mega project involving 21 metropolitan cities with the goal of ‘building a new Ukraine’ at the OXYGREN Summit in Liverpool in July 2023. The Global TWIN CITIES can create a network of the global metropolitan cities that can work together to develop and implement of the joint future city projects and will have a huge impact on Ukraine’s reconstruction by replicating the proven solutions and infrastructures from the joint project carried out by the participating cities in the post-war Ukraine.
In addition, Mr. Chun has 15-year experiences in fostering 300+ tech startups in London and New York as a founder and CEO of XnTREE. XnTREE is a tech accelerator and investor in smart city projects and located in London and New York.
